Hi there, today i had to update some drivers....everything went smoothly until i had to update my USB's on my pc, on reboot my keyboard and mouse kicked in as normal until windows started loading, then the lights on my usb wired mouse and usb wired keyboard both went out and no longer worked...thinking i had broken my keyboard and mouse i went straight out and replaced them both, but i still have exactly the same problem, on start up both mouse and keyboard load up but on loading of windows they both stop working...dont know if the following info is useful or not but OS is Windows XP Pro. many thanks to all who respond :)

Surprised you have not had a n answer yet, with all the techies here. I think (and only think) that the bios that starts your operating system has default mouse and keyboard drivers. once the OS kicks in the proper drivers for the usb are started, that's when the trouble starts.

When you start your computer watch the screen, you'll probably see a line on the bottom to inform you which function key to press to load up the restore function on your OS.
